Drechttunnel closed down after truck accident

The Drechttunnel on the A16 towards Rotterdam has been closed down after a truck lost its load of Fristi. The yogurt drink is now covering the tunnel floor. The truck driver was driving under the influence of alcohol and fell asleep behind the wheel, according to RTL Nieuws. The truck hit the tunnel wall and lost its load when the driver fell asleep. The badly damaged vehicle came to a halt a few meters away. Rijkswaterstaat expects that the tunnel will be closed until at least 10:45 a.m. while the truck is being recovered and the yogurt is cleaned off the road. According to the ANWB, all traffic is now being directed through the left side of the tunnel. This will likely cause a delay. https://twitter.com/WIS_Wilco/status/630618125826945024
